Which phrase best helps the reader understand the meaning of the word dupe in the sentence? Matthew realized that Kara was trying to dupe him. He was angry, and wished she had been honest with him.

A. He was angry
B. Matthew realized
C .had been honest
D. was trying to

Answer:

C. had been honest

Step-by-step explanation:

Option C serves as a context clue that gives us the opposite meaning of the word "dupe" and thus, it helps us find out the true meaning of that word by contrast.

By looking at this phrase, then, we can infer that Kara was trying to deceive, to trick or to swindle Matt because of what comes next: Matthew got angry and wished she had been honest with him, in other words, he wished Kara had done the opposite of what she did.
